MÖTLEY CRÜE and DEF LEPPARD have announced two U.S. shows for February 2023. The two bands, who recently teamed up for the mega-successful "The Stadium Tour", will play at the 7,000-capacity Hard Rock Live at Etess Arena in Atlantic City, New Jersey on February 10 and February 11.
